fans were rocked by the deaths of Lady Sybil and Matthew Crawley after actors Jessica Brown Findlay and Dan Stevens asked to leave the uber-popular show, and now another actor has chosen to walk out Downton's door: Siobhan Finneran, who plays O'Brien!

"I'm not doing any more," Finneran said in a recent interview. "O'Brien is a thoroughly despicable human being -- that was great to play." A spokesperson for Downton confirmed the news to HuffPo UK.


RELATED - Rob James-Collier Talks Thomas' Redemption

The Grimm Reaper will most likely stay away this time as creator Julian Fellowes previously said, "When an actor playing a servant wants to leave, there isn't really a problem -- [that character gets] another job," he says. "With members of the family, once they're not prepared to come back for any episodes at all, then it means death. Because how believable would it be that Matthew never wanted to see the baby, never wanted to see his wife? And was never seen again at the estate that he was the heir to? So we didn't have any option, really. I was as sorry as everyone else."

The fourth season of Downton Abbey is currently filming in England.
